Why Traceability Matters in Food Manufacturing


Food traceability refers to the ability to track the journey of food products from their origin to the final consumer. This process is crucial for several reasons:

  1. Consumer Safety: Ensuring the safety of food products is paramount. Traceability helps in quickly identifying the source of contamination in case of a foodborne illness outbreak, thereby reducing the risk to consumers.

  2. Regulatory Compliance: Food manufacturers must adhere to stringent regulations and standards set by government bodies. Traceability software helps companies comply with these requirements by maintaining accurate records and facilitating audits.

  3. Quality Control: Monitoring the entire production process allows manufacturers to maintain consistent quality and address any issues that arise promptly. This includes tracking ingredients, processing conditions, and final product testing.

  4. Supply Chain Transparency: With increasing consumer demand for transparency, food manufacturers need to provide clear information about the origins and handling of their products. Traceability software enables this transparency by documenting every step of the supply chain.

Key Features of Food Manufacturing Traceability Software


Food manufacturing traceability software offers a range of features designed to enhance tracking, management, and reporting capabilities. Here are some of the most important features:

  1. Real-Time Tracking: This feature allows manufacturers to monitor the movement of ingredients and products in real-time. It provides up-to-date information on inventory levels, production stages, and distribution.

  2. Batch and Lot Tracking: By tracking batches and lots, manufacturers can pinpoint the exact origin and destination of each product. This is essential for identifying and isolating contaminated products quickly.

  3. Barcode and RFID Integration: Traceability software often integrates with barcode and RFID technologies to streamline data collection and enhance accuracy. This integration helps in scanning and recording information at various points in the supply chain.

  4. Automated Record-Keeping: The software automates the process of recording and storing data, reducing the likelihood of human error and ensuring that records are accurate and easily accessible.

  5. Compliance Management: Features that support compliance with regulatory standards and industry best practices are crucial. The software helps generate reports, maintain documentation, and prepare for audits.

  6. Data Analytics and Reporting: Advanced analytics tools enable manufacturers to analyze data trends, track performance metrics, and generate detailed reports. This information is valuable for continuous improvement and decision-making.

  7. Recall Management: In the event of a recall, traceability software simplifies the process by identifying affected products, notifying stakeholders, and managing the recall efficiently.

Benefits of Implementing Traceability Software

The adoption of food manufacturing traceability software offers numerous benefits:

  1. Enhanced Food Safety: By providing real-time visibility and accurate tracking, the software helps prevent and manage food safety issues, ensuring that products meet safety standards.

  2. Increased Efficiency: Automation of data collection and record-keeping reduces manual effort, minimizes errors, and speeds up processes. This leads to improved operational efficiency and cost savings.

  3. Improved Customer Trust: Transparency in the supply chain builds consumer trust. Being able to provide detailed information about the origins and handling of products enhances the brand’s reputation and fosters customer loyalty.

  4. Regulatory Compliance: Traceability software simplifies compliance with food safety regulations and standards, helping manufacturers avoid fines and legal issues.

  5. Better Decision-Making: Access to comprehensive data and analytics enables manufacturers to make informed decisions, optimize processes, and address potential issues proactively.

Choosing the Right Traceability Software

When selecting food manufacturing traceability software, consider the following factors:

  1. Scalability: Ensure that the software can grow with your business and accommodate increasing data and complexity.

  2. Integration Capabilities: The software should integrate seamlessly with existing systems, such as ERP and inventory management systems.

  3. User-Friendliness: Choose a solution that is easy to use and requires minimal training for staff.

  4. Support and Maintenance: Opt for a provider that offers robust support and regular updates to keep the software current with industry standards.
